Project - Data Engineer
Job Description
This on-site role is based in Deloitte’s Rochester, NY delivery hub, where data engineering drives analytics outcomes for clients. The Project - Data Engineer focuses on building and refining data pipelines on AWS and Snowflake, delivering analytics-ready datasets, and boosting data quality and observability within project delivery teams. The salary range for this role is USD 57,300 to 95,500 per year.
Responsibilities
- Design and improve AWS-based data pipelines using Python to ingest, transform, and supply data to Snowflake and downstream consumers.
- Create and maintain Snowflake schemas, tables, and views, and implement efficient SQL transformations to yield analytics-ready datasets.
- Set up workflow automation and scheduling using Airflow or MWAA, Step Functions, or Glue, including dependencies, retries, and logging.
- Incorporate data quality checks and basic observability (validation rules, reconciliations, alerts) and assist with incident triage and remediation.
- Optimize pipelines and queries following best practices, including efficient Python code, S3 partitioning and file formats (Parquet, Delta), and Snowflake warehouse tuning.
- Adhere to CI/CD and IaC standards, utilizing Git-based workflows and Terraform or CloudFormation changes to promote code across environments.
- Collaborate with analysts, product owners, and source-system teams to clarify requirements and validate outputs, and participate in sprint ceremonies and estimations.
- Contribute to code reviews, write and review unit tests, assist with peer debugging, and adopt team engineering standards.
- Communicate regularly with Engagement Managers, Directors, project teammates, and diverse functional or technical stakeholders, escalating issues that require engagement management attention.
- Lead client engagement workstreams, independently or with others, focused on process improvement, optimization, and transformation, including implementing best-practice workflows and addressing quality deficits to drive operational outcomes.
Requirements
- Over one year of experience building and enhancing data pipelines and curated datasets for analytics and downstream consumers.
- At least one year of hands-on SQL and Python experience, including Snowflake and/or PySpark for transformations and scalable processing.
- Minimum of one year in cloud data engineering on AWS (preferred) or Azure/GCP, with orchestration/scheduling using Airflow/MWAA, Step Functions, Glue, or ADF/Fabric Data Factory.
- Understanding of ELT patterns and lakehouse/warehouse concepts; familiarity with S3 file formats and partitioning such as Parquet or Delta.
- Working knowledge of DevOps practices, including Git-based workflows and CI/CD, plus exposure to Infrastructure-as-Code tools such as Terraform or CloudFormation.
- Understanding of data quality, basic observability, and metadata/governance fundamentals.
- Bachelor’s degree, ideally in computer science, information technology, computer engineering, or a related IT discipline, or equivalent experience.
